1.

Reenter the incorrect data, but instead of pressing



, press

{ 

. This

deletes the value(s) and decrements n.

2.

Enter the correct value(s) using



.

If the incorrect values were the ones just entered, press

{ 

to retrieve

them, then press

{ 

to delete them. (The incorrect y–value was still in the

Y–register, and its x–value was saved in the LAST X register.)
